Load only new and unused containers on the analyzer Load only new and unused containers on the analyzer Load only new and unused containers on the analyzer An IMT fluid container can be refilled The same IMT fluid container can be loaded multiple times Which of the following is TRUE regarding replacing the IMT fluids on the CI Analyzer? Question 7 of 10 Select the best answer. Multiple Choice Question Do not load the same IMT fluids container multiple times. Removing and reloading an IMT fluid container can cause the punctured membrane to leak. Do not refill an IMT fluid container. Refilling a container can cause contamination.
